Before the incident
Employee was working Utility Route.
What happened
Employee was taking totes off the WIP in Molding to put onto Utility cart. Totes were placed sideways on the WIP with handles facing inward. Employee lifted tote up and turned it on the WIP when she felt pain in her left wrist.
Injury or illness
wrist sprain
Object or substance involved
Tote
